Renzo Akkerman is a leading researcher in production and supply chain management, with a particular focus on sustainable operations, food supply chains, and advanced manufacturing systems. His work bridges operational efficiency and environmental responsibility, addressing critical challenges in how goods are produced and distributed. Among his notable contributions is the 2019 study "Robotic-cell scheduling with pick-up constraints and uncertain processing times," which tackles the complexities of integrating robotic automation into uncertain production environments. This paper, cited 12 times, proposes innovative scheduling models for dual-gripper robotic cells, advancing the practical deployment of automation in manufacturing. Akkerman’s research has been widely recognized for its impact on both theory and industry practice, with his broader body of work accumulating over 1,000 citations. He has also made significant strides in food supply chain logistics, emphasizing waste reduction and quality preservation. Through his publications in top-tier journals, Akkerman continues to shape how researchers and practitioners approach the intersection of automation, sustainability, and operational decision-making.
